About the position

The Data Entry Clerk / Office Assistant will provide essential technical and administrative support to a professional learning organization that serves a large network of charter schools across the state. This role involves data entry, document management, communication with stakeholders, and technical support, assisting in implementing professional learning programs and facilitating teacher certification processes.

Responsibilities

  • Accurately enter and manage data related to professional learning activities, reimbursement procedures, and certification processes.
  • Organize and maintain records, ensuring that all documents are properly stored, managed, and accessible when needed.
  • Respond to inquiries from school leaders, teachers, and other stakeholders, providing clear and accurate information on professional learning programs and certification requirements.
  • Assist the Director of Professional Learning and other team leads in the development and implementation of professional learning initiatives.
  • Provide technical support to staff and stakeholders, ensuring that systems and tools used for professional learning and certification are functioning effectively.
  • Collaborate with various departments to ensure that professional learning programs meet state requirements and organizational goals.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; an associate's degree or additional training in office administration, data management, or a related field is preferred.
  • Previous experience in data entry, office administration, or a similar role is preferred.
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y in data entry and document management.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to interact professionally with a wide range of stakeholders.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and familiarity with data management systems.
